Uncovering Gray Hawk Nests: The Role of Volunteers

birding in southern Arizona

Uncovering Gray Hawk Nests: The Power of Volunteer Contributions

In the vast landscapes of southern Arizona, birding enthusiasts and volunteers play a pivotal role in conservation efforts, particularly when it comes to rare species like the Gray Hawk. These dedicated individuals are often the eyes and ears on the ground, actively participating in bird surveys and habitat monitoring. Through their diligent work, they can identify and document nesting sites, which is crucial for understanding and protecting these elusive raptors.

Volunteers equipped with knowledge of birding in southern Arizona become invaluable assets during the spring and summer seasons when Gray Hawks breed. They meticulously search for signs of nests, such as stick structures or scattered feather duvets, often high up in mesquite trees or on rocky outcrops. By reporting their findings to conservation organizations and researchers, these volunteers contribute to a growing body of data that helps track population trends and inform management strategies. Their efforts not only enhance our understanding of the Gray Hawk’s habitat preferences but also ensure that protective measures are in place for these remarkable birds.
